I received a letter that looked like a certificate with a green background. It said that I could not be turned down if I sent in a payment of either $45.00 or $49.00 for rush delivery. I was to have a credit limit of up to $5000.00 and no interest for one year. As soon as I received the card I would be able to begin making purchases.

This was very important to me since I am a student with a brand new apartment and a baby on the way and I have only a couch and a bed. After I realized that my check had cleared the bank. I began looking for my card in the mail, since I sent $49.00 for rush delivery after a couple of days I decided to look on the internet for a number to their office to find out the status of my card. I found the website for them. However the deal they were offering said it was a card that could only be used for purchases through their online store and that $49.00 was their annual fee for the card and although there was no "downpayment" required on your purchases you did have to send 35% plus shipping and handling.

Well suffice it to say, I did not want that card or that deal. So in my attempts to find out more, I come across this website that spoke of being ripped off and the company had the same name as the credit card company. I read some of them and came across a lady who described exactly what I was told on my green certificate. I put two and two together.
